ABSTRACT = {Prostate cancer is a heterogeneous disease and clinical
outcomes vary considerably after failure of primary
androgen ablation. With the development of new
therapeutics the management of patients with androgen
independent prostate cancer has changed considerably
over the last few years. Multiple secondary hormonal manipulations are available and may lead to prolonged
periods of clinical response. These maneuvers include
the use of oral antiandrogens, antiandrogen withdrawal,
ketoconazole, aminoglutethimide, corticosteroids and use
of estrogenic compounds. This article reviews the clinical
activity of these agents in management of patients with
advanced prostate cancer.},
